Authvia joins the Infinicept Partner Network
By Edlyn Cardoza
Infinicept, a leading provider of embedded payments, recently announced that Authvia, the maker of conversational commerce solutions that enable instant payment acceptance on contactless channels such as text, social media, chat, email, and messenger, has joined the Infinicept Partner Network, a curated community of solution providers that helps software and FinTech companies transform to the new era of software-led payments.
The collaboration between Infinicept and Authvia accelerates the trend of software-led payments, helping meet the evolving needs of companies as they embed payments into their digital experiences, leading to full control over their payments journey.
As part of the Partner Network and through each platform’s existing APIs, Infinicept’s customers can automate setup and onboarding for their merchants and launch TXT2PAY with little to no development.

Infinicept’s universal platform approach enables its customers to work with their choice of underwriting services, payment processors, gateway, and terminal providers.
